編集の要約なし
編集の要約なし
1行目: 1行目:
[[ファイル:JavaScript_logo.png|thumb|JavaScript|300px]]
[[ファイル:JavaScript_logo.png|thumb|JavaScript|300px]]


JavaScript とは、Webブラウザからサーバ、さらにデスクトップやモバイルアプリまで、<strong>マシンレイヤーを幅広くカバーする万能フルスタック言語</strong>
JavaScript とは、Webブラウザからサーバ、さらにデスクトップやモバイルアプリまで、<strong>マシンレイヤーを幅広くカバーする万能フルスタック言語</strong>。C/C++製の「V8 - Chrome」や「JavaScriptCore - Safari」などのエンジンで動く。


1995年12月、Netscapeが JavaScript を正式リリース、1996年11月には全てのWebブラウザやベンダーが準拠できる標準仕様を作るために Ecma Internationalに提出。1997年6月に最初のECMAScript言語仕様が正式にリリース。
1995年12月、Netscapeが JavaScript を正式リリース、1996年11月には全てのWebブラウザやベンダーが準拠できる標準仕様を作るために Ecma Internationalに提出。1997年6月に最初のECMAScript言語仕様が正式にリリース。


当初はブラウザ上でページに動きや美しい視覚効果を与えることを目的に開発されていたが、2000年のV8エンジン登場を機にGoogleの養子になり、サーバサイドやモバイルアプリ開発もカバーするフルスタック言語に急成長した。ただし商標は Oracl保有。
当初はブラウザ上でページに動きや美しい視覚効果を与えることを目的に開発されていたが、2000年のV8エンジン登場を機にGoogleの養子になり、サーバサイドやモバイルアプリ開発もカバーするフルスタック言語に急成長した。


C/C++製の「V8 - Chrome」や「JavaScriptCore - Safari」などのエンジンで動く。
ただし商標は Oracl保有なので「JS」や「ES6」と呼ばれたりする。

2025年3月30日 (日) 21:16時点における版

JavaScript

JavaScript とは、Webブラウザからサーバ、さらにデスクトップやモバイルアプリまで、マシンレイヤーを幅広くカバーする万能フルスタック言語。C/C++製の「V8 - Chrome」や「JavaScriptCore - Safari」などのエンジンで動く。

1995年12月、Netscapeが JavaScript を正式リリース、1996年11月には全てのWebブラウザやベンダーが準拠できる標準仕様を作るために Ecma Internationalに提出。1997年6月に最初のECMAScript言語仕様が正式にリリース。

当初はブラウザ上でページに動きや美しい視覚効果を与えることを目的に開発されていたが、2000年のV8エンジン登場を機にGoogleの養子になり、サーバサイドやモバイルアプリ開発もカバーするフルスタック言語に急成長した。

ただし商標は Oracl保有なので「JS」や「ES6」と呼ばれたりする。